Fauci feared he would never ‘return to normal’ after contracting West Nile virus

  • Fauci described his severe West Nile virus experience as “terrifying,” nearly leading to his downfall, in his first public statement after hospitalization in August.
  • His experience has motivated him to push for international vaccine and antiviral development for mosquito-borne diseases, worsened by climate change.
  • The World Health Organization reports that about 1 in 5 infected people will develop a fever, and 1 in 150 may experience serious illness from West Nile virus.
